As the ongoing floods in Himachal Pradesh have caused widespread loss to property(homes and businesses) and infrastructure, the IRDAI on Friday asked general insurers and standalone health insurance companies to mobilise all resources to ensure that all claims are surveyed immediately and claim payments / on account payments are disbursed at the earliest.
